Founded in 2001, Coalfire is a fast-growing Cyber Risk and Compliance firm, serving as a trusted advisor and IT GRC tools-provider to security-conscious leaders in Retail, Financial Services, Healthcare, Hospitality, Higher Education, Government and Utilities. We help our clients recognize and control IT-related risks and maintain compliance with all major industry and government standards. We’ve been in the IT security business for as long as it has existed. One of our first clients was a major credit card processor that was compromised by a major cyber-attack. We investigated the breach, uncovered the root causes and helped create a controls program that protects our client to this day. More importantly, that firm is now a recognized leader among its peers and continues to successfully protect itself against increasingly sophisticated (and daily) attacks. Today, Coalfire serves thousands of clients across the U.S., Canada and the UK. We are privately-held by our co-founders and a small group of outside investors. We're growing rapidly, hiring additional talent, and investing in Navis, Coalfire’s cloud-based compliance management solution.
We provide security testing and analysis for clients in a wide range of industries. The work we do includes network and application testing, hardware hacking, social engineering, vulnerability research and more. Right now, we’re ramping up to fill multiple entry- and mid-level positions specifically on our penetration testing team. These openings are primarily focused on network and web application tests, code reviews, social engineering, physical security assessments and security architecture consulting. 
  • 5+ years of experience in information security with application/network penetration testing experience
  • Deep understanding of web frameworks, including XML, SOAP, JSON and Ajax
  • Experience with scripting languages such as, bash, PERL, Python, ruby, vb/wscript or powershell
  • Experience exploiting web applications and services
  • Experience with .NET web application frameworks and languages
  • Understanding of C, C#, Objective C and Java.
  • Familiarity with web proxy tools such as Paros and/or Burp
  • Familiarity with penetration testing tools such as BackTrack, NeXpose, Nessus, nmap, Metasploit, vulnerability scanners, tcpdump, wireshark, etc.
  • Experience with debuggers and disassemblers
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ills
  • Self-motivated and able to work both independently and with a team.
  • Familiarity with Open Source Security Testing Methodology Manual (OSSTMM), Open Web Application Security Project (OWASP) and National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) Special Publications.
  • Experience using Rapid7 Nexpose and Metasploit, and commercial web application testing tools such as BurpSuite Pro
  • Experience leading or participating on Red Team engagements
  • Working knowledge of firewalls and other network security products.
  • Knowledge of applied cryptographic protocols.
  • CISSP, OSCP/E, GWAPT, GPEN, GXPN certification a plus.
  • Experience in exploit development
  • Experience in hardware hacking or embedded systems hacking
  • Advanced degree in an IT related field is a plus.
